Transaction 1cc772f6c7f3b0e152c79307a86be7427caf675563cf5c71e97fc7b09b591e23

1 Input
2 Outputs
  • 1cc772f6c7f3b0e152c79307a86be7427caf675563cf5c71e97fc7b09b591e23:0
  • value  340125014
    address  3KMrFRdwXW9bgvzNJHiEfuyt8pPBjEeuQu
  • 1cc772f6c7f3b0e152c79307a86be7427caf675563cf5c71e97fc7b09b591e23:1
  • value  205752390
    address  1JJf87LLAuirVF3iFWx2amJbku1i6JJm9x